Advanced Practice Week 2025 – Save the Date!

Oct 28, 2025

National Advanced Practice Week is an annual event which takes place 10-14 November. To mark this, NHS Lanarkshire’s practice development team has developed a series of webinars which will focus on advanced practice across all sectors within NHS Lanarkshire.

Advanced Practice Week aims to support the learning and development of advanced practitioners and trainee advanced practitioners across the organisation. Providing this continuous professional development opportunity for advanced practitioners and trainees will contribute to their knowledge and skills and help ensure safe and efficient practices, reducing the risk of harm to patients.

Penny Brankin, senior practitioner, practice development, said: “As part of Advanced Practice Week we will be holding a series of varied and interesting webinars – both live and recorded – to meet the learning needs of NHS Lanarkshire’s advanced practice community and trainees so that we can ensure they have contemporary, evidence-based knowledge to help in safe advanced practice across all four pillars of practice.

“If anyone is an advanced practitioner or training to become one, this is a great opportunity to enhance their learning and support their continuous professional development”.
